Volunteer at local Food Bank or charity
Food banks and other charities will be providing emergency winter services to help people in your area who may be experiencing food insecurity. Many of these services are volunteer run. They may need help with serving food, stacking shelves, or driving food to different locations.
Get in touch with your local food bank or charity to see what type of help they may need this winter.
